About Chandori Kh Village

Chandori Kh is a mid sized village in Tirora tehsil, in the district of Gondiya, Maharashtra.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,639, made up of 849 males and 790 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 931 females per 1000 males. The village covers 468.33 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 441911,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Chandori Kh

The census records public bus service for Chandori Kh as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
